The charity supports the general public. Winwood Heath Allotment is a registered charity whose purpose is the environment, conservation, or heritage. It delivers its work by providing buildings, facilities, or open space. The charity is based in West Midlands and operates in Birmingham City, Coventry City, and various other locations.

Activities & Mission

To provide allotments for the parishioners of Romsley and local areas
